Hello Starpoint Families,
The Starpoint PTA has many activities and events planned for March and the remaining months of the year. First, we are very busy planning our
Spaghetti Dinner on Thursday, March 16th. The annual event brings to-gether Starpoint families and the community for a special evening of dinner and theater that’s not to be missed! Come for dinner before the show and be served by your favorite teacher or principal! For ticket prices and more details, please see the flyer included in this newsletter. Starpoint PTA will also sponsor Family Math Night at Fricano on March 23rd, a fun evening where families can play games together while learning math!
Our PTA Spirit Wear sale is back by popular demand! Show your support for Starpoint with our custom apparel, for sale online only through March 12! The 4th and 5th Grade Spelling Bees are coming up in the month of April with the Regional PTA Bee for finalists to follow in May. More info will come home later this month and students can find a link for the word lists to study on the Regan Intermediate website. Good luck!
During our next monthly board meeting on Wednesday, March 8th at 6:30 in the high school cafeteria, we will have a brief presentation of awards for our Reflections arts program participants. It’s also “Bring A Friend Night” so stop by with a friend for some refreshments and a chance to win a prize. You don’t even have to be a member to attend! Enter the “D” parking lot and use the Arts and Athletics entrance.
